Friebis & Associates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Friebis & Associates in the United States is $79,532.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$38. Salaries at Friebis & Associates typically range from $69,899 to $89,979 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Friebis & Associates
Take a look at our Home page. Friebis & Associates is a full service tax, accounting and business consulting firm located in Port Orange, FL.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Daytona Beach?

Understanding the cost of living near Daytona Beach is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Friebis & Associates.
Daytona Beach's Cost of Living Index is approximately 90.3 (9.7% less expensive than US average; 12.4% less than FL average). Atlantic coast city, 'World's Most Famous Beach', affordable housing.
